1. Declutter Your House

Removing clutter will help reduce hidden dust and dirt in your home. It also makes it significantly easier to clean up the house! Try and get rid of things you don’t use that pick up a lot of dust, for example old magazines and newspapers. The most important place to focus on is your bedroom – you spend at least 7 hours in there every day, so make every hour allergy-free!

2. Weekly Washes

You should be washing your linen (sheets, duvet cover and pillow cases) at least once a week! Not washing them will cause a build-up of dust mites, leading to worsened allergies and if your super unlucky – bed bugs.

3. Make Your Bathroom Sparkle

If left uncleaned your bathroom can become a haven for mould and bacteria – making life harder for people who tend to experience allergy related reactions. Make sure to regularly clean the bathroom with non-toxic cleaner, inspect water pipes for leaks and fix, clean away mould on pipes and fixtures and have a running bathroom ventilation fan.

4. Keep Your Carpets Clean

Considering how much dust catches in carpet fibres, and the dust and dirt that gets carried through the door, a good quality vacuum cleaner is a life saver when it comes to dust. Since we spend so much time indoors during the colder months, the likelihood of allergy related irritations are higher. A thorough vacuum will be able to catch more allergens and keep your floors in tip-top shape – and keep your pets happy too! Make sure you give your floors a deep and thorough clean with a natural cleaner or carpet shampoo to get rid of old and new stains in the process.
